Inconel 600 (UNS N06600) Seamless Pipes & Tubes Manufacturer & Supplier
Alloy 600 (Inconel 600, UNS N06600) is a nickel-chromium alloy with good oxidation resistance at high temperatures and resistance to chloride-ion stress corrosion cracking. It is widely used in the nuclear industry, chemical processing, and for components that must resist caustic environments.
UNS: N06600 | Category: Nickel Alloy | Werkstoff Nr: 2.4816 | EN Name: NiCr15Fe

Chemical Composition (%)
| Ni | Cr | Fe | C | Mn | Si | Cu | S |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 72.0 min | 14.0-17.0 | 6.0-10.0 | 0.15 max | 1.00 max | 0.50 max | 0.50 max | 0.015 max |
Mechanical Properties
- Tensile Strength
- 550 MPa min
- Yield Strength
- 240 MPa min
- Elongation
- 30% min
- Hardness
- 90 HRB max
Physical Properties
- Density
- 8.47 g/cm3
- Melting Range
- 1354-1413 C
- Thermal Conductivity
- 14.8 W/m-K
- Electrical Resistivity
- 1030 nOhm-m
- Specific Heat
- 444 J/kg-K
- Coeff. of Thermal Expansion
- 13.3 um/m-C

Applications
- Nuclear reactor components
- Chemical and food processing
- Furnace components and heat treatment
- Caustic evaporators
- Aerospace and gas turbine components
- Electronic and thermocouple sheathing
